An afternoon of music and stories with Chicago's celebrated musical supergroup, Funkadesi who will be sharing music from their 25-year repertoire. Deeply rooted in tradition, their music ranges from South Asian classical, folk and film melodies, to West African, Caribbean, Latin, Brazilian, and Reggae blended with American Funk and Soul. They will also be sharing the stories of their music and instruments.
Funkadesi will offer an informative hands on demonstration of their instruments starting 30 minutes prior to the beginning of the music and dance program. To further help kids understand the music and cultures being showcased.

The band has represented Chicago throughout the United States and Canada, at music festivals, performing art centers, venues, clubs, and special events including performing for a young, IL Senator, Barack Obama, who noted "There's a lot of funks in that desi." The group has also used music to promote personal and community growth and social connectedness.
